I work in a company which we use Tomcat (5.5.26 and recently we've upgraded
it to 6.0.29) to run our application.

The tomcat is running on servers with OS windows 2008 R2 STD.



The problem is-

Until now, we used [b]SQL Authentication[/b] for the tomcat service and
configuration (user and password for tomcat to access the DB was provided
within the xml configuration file, under c:\Program Files\Apache Software
Foundation\Tomcat 6.0\conf\catalina\localhost), but! since we changed
configuration to use [b]Windows Authentication [/b](the user that runs
tomcat is now a domain user with permissions on the DB + removed user and
password from xml configuration file), we observed a trend of memory leak,
where it comes to attention by the process of tomcat, which is increasing on
a daily basis.



do you know why is it happening?

and what can I do to stop the memory leak (other than switching back to SQL
authentication).
